This is an outstanding opportunity for a Head of Retail Broking to take the lead of a hugely successful personal lines insurance brokerage based in Eastleigh.
Our client is part of a large broking group that controls £60M in gross written premium. It specialises in niche Private Car Insurance (High Performance, Modified, Imported, Classic Cars etc), as well as a small amount of Residential Property Risks. This is an extremely exciting and growing PE-backed business with circa 40 staff, where there are lots of opportunities to make your mark on taking this organisation to the next level.
The company’s mission is to become a top 20 UK broker, recognised as the go-to partner for high-quality insurance businesses across the UK. It plans to achieve this by embracing innovation, staying ahead of evolving client needs and building a culture where great people thrive.
In this varied and challenging role, you will be responsible for shaping the broking and distribution strategy, managing key relationships, onboarding new partnerships and ensuring the delivery of high-quality insurance solutions across the retail portfolio. As part of the senior managers team, you’ll work with colleagues to identify and onboard potential acquisitions, identify areas to collaborate and promote the group to internal and external stakeholders.
This is a fast-paced role within a continually-evolving business, and so you must enjoy working in this kind of environment and embracing change. You’ll be an inspirational leader, with strong commercial acumen, and you’ll have the ability to recognise and capitalise upon opportunities in the market.
You’ll have proven leadership experience in personal lines insurance, including Private Motor insurance. Some exposure to non-standard Motor risks would certainly be beneficial, although this is by no means essential. You must have strong commercial acumen and strategic thinking, excellent interpersonal and communication skills, together with a deep understanding of insurance products, market dynamics, and regulatory frameworks. Just as important is a track record of driving growth and managing change.
Opportunities are plentiful within this growing organisation; both within this specific business, as well as the wider Group. As such, the sky really is the limit here when it comes to your career and professional development.
This is an office-based role (5 days a week, 9am-5pm) in Eastleigh. You’ll be rewarded with an attractive salary (Negotiable, depending on experience), together with a highly lucrative performance-based bonus and range of company benefits.
